Srinagar: Pakistan on Tuesday violated ceasefire in Baaz and Nambla areas of Uri Sector in Baramulla District of and .

Indian forces are heavily retaliating and a major gun battle is underway.

According to reports, a woman has been injured in the firing. This is the first case of cross border firing that has been reported today on the occasion of 's 71st Independence Day.
